Unna-Politzer naevus


Also known as:
Unna's mark
Unna’s nevus

Associated persons:
Adam Politzer
Paul Gerson Unna

Description:
A pale, salmon-coloured birthmark found on the nape of the neck in 25 to 50 percent of normal persons. Inheritance is autosomal dominant.

Bibliography:
  • W. B. Shelley, C. S. Livingood:
    Familial multiple nevi flammei.
    Archives of Dermatology and Syphilology, Chicago, 1949, 59: 343-345.
